LOUISVILLE, Ky. – Freshman Ava Laurent was tabbed the Division II Wilson/NFCA Pitcher of the Week of the Week Tuesday (Mar. 12).
Laurent is the first recipient of the pitching award in program history since the National Fastpitch Coaches Association introduced the weekly award with a pitcher and player categories in 2014. Two Gorillas have earning the award as the Division II Louisville Slugger/Player of the Week in Paxtyn Hayes (2023) and Tiffany Brown (2014).
The Grand Island, Neb., native went 3-0 with a 0.00 ERA through 21 innings of work last week. She fanned 38 batters and issues just two walks while posting a 0.67 WHIP and limiting opposing hitters to a .162 batting average.
To begin her week she struck out 10 Golden Suns on the road Tuesday (Mar. 5) in a 5-0 win against Arkansas Tech. She followed that up with back-to-back 14 strikeout performances against Central Missouri (Mar. 9) and Lincoln (Mar. 10) to begin the conference slate.
Among MIAA ranks she is now first in strikeouts (107) and opposing batting average (.183), third in innings pitched (73.0) and victories (9) and fourth in ERA (1.25).
